Output 01905125dc5090caba7856065c729f1eb4ad36e18eeffdc43d181afa11481603:0

value
6200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da0045f1bfe511d093984f8de476c36e41de7f21 OP_EQUAL
address
3MZhZM3hjp75Zvs5ArEn413i8T91wU5H9b
transaction
01905125dc5090caba7856065c729f1eb4ad36e18eeffdc43d181afa11481603
confirmations
351161
spent
true